    FAQs About Miyabi-Chan Down From The Moon

    What is the main premise of Miyabi-Chan Down From The Moon?

    Miyabi-Chan Down From The Moon follows the journey of Miyabi, a celestial being who descends to Earth, exploring themes of love, loss, and belonging as she navigates her new life among humans.

    Who are the main characters in the manga?

    The main character is Miyabi, accompanied by a diverse cast of supporting characters who each represent different aspects of human experience, contributing to her growth and understanding of love and connection.

    What themes are explored in the manga?

    The manga delves into themes of love in its various forms, the pain of loss, and the search for belonging, all woven together through Miyabi's experiences and relationships.

    How does the art style enhance the story?

    The art style employs a vibrant color palette, dynamic panel layouts, and rich symbolism to enhance the emotional impact of the narrative, allowing readers to connect more deeply with the characters and their journeys.

    What makes Miyabi-Chan Down From The Moon unique?

    The manga's unique blend of celestial and earthly elements, along with its exploration of profound themes through relatable characters, sets it apart as a captivating and thought-provoking read.
